Utilisation des Fonctions SQL dans Supabase

Apprenez à exploiter les fonctions SQL de Supabase pour gérer des opérations complexes sur vos données.

Détails de la leçon

Description de la leçon

Cette leçon explore l'utilisation des fonctions SQL dans Supabase, un outil puissant pour gérer les bases de données collaboratives modernes. Nous visons à montrer comment utiliser ces fonctions pour réaliser des actions plus complexes que celles possibles via une API classique. Elle inclut des exemples pratiques de création et d'exécution de fonctions permettant d'afficher, par département, le nombre de tickets avec différents statuts. La leçon aborde également l'utilisation de l'assistant intégré dans Supabase pour faciliter la rédaction de requêtes SQL, et met en lumière la flexibilité du système pour générer des résultats structurés tels que JSON, offrant ainsi des options pour gérer les données de manière dynamique. En conclusion, la compréhension et l'application des fonctions SQL rendent l'interface Supabase non seulement plus robuste mais aussi plus adaptée aux besoins sophistiqués des projets en production.

Objectifs de cette leçon

Les objectifs incluent l'acquisition des compétences nécessaires pour créer et utiliser des fonctions SQL dans Supabase, afin de gérer des opérations complexes et automatiser les tâches répétitives.

Prérequis pour cette leçon

Une compréhension de base des bases de données SQL et une expérience préalable avec Supabase sont recommandées.

Métiers concernés

Ces compétences sont particulièrement utiles pour les développeurs backend, les analystes de données et les ingénieurs data qui travaillent avec des plateformes cloud modernes.

Alternatives et ressources

Parmi les alternatives possibles, on peut envisager d'utiliser PostgreSQL directement ou d'autres systèmes de gestion de bases de données relationnels comme MySQL.

Questions & Réponses

Les fonctions SQL dans Supabase permettent d'effectuer des opérations complexes et répétitives en une seule requête, améliorant ainsi l'efficacité et la cohérence.
L'assistant de Supabase simplifie la création de fonctions en suggérant des snippets et en vérifiant la syntaxe, réduisant ainsi le risque d'erreurs et accélérant le processus de développement.
Les fonctions SQL dans Supabase peuvent retourner des tables complexes, des calculs agrégés, ou des structures JSON, ce qui offre une grande flexibilité dans la gestion des résultats.